What are the basics of car cleaning and care?
The basics include regular washing of the exterior, cleaning of the interior, and care of the paint surface. It is important to use gentle cleaning agents and microfiber cloths to avoid scratches. Regular waxing helps protect the paint.
How often should I clean my car?
Ideally, you should wash your car every two weeks. If it is heavily soiled or during the pollen and winter seasons, more frequent cleaning may be necessary. A thorough interior cleaning is recommended at least once a month.
Which products are best for car cleaning?
pH-neutral shampoos are recommended for exterior cleaning. Special cockpit cleaners are suitable for cleaning the interior and leather care products for leather surfaces. Avoid harsh chemicals that can damage the paint or interior.
How can I avoid scratches and streaks when washing my car?
Always use clean microfiber cloths and soft sponges. Do not wash the car in direct sunlight and rinse the dirt thoroughly before washing. When washing, work in straight lines rather than circular motions.
What steps are necessary to thoroughly clean the interior of my car?
Start by vacuuming the interior, including the seats and floor mats. Clean the dashboard and other surfaces with an appropriate cleaner. Don't forget to clean windows and mirrors and treat leather surfaces if necessary.
Can I polish my car myself, and if so, how?
Yes, you can polish your car yourself. Use a mild polish and a polishing cloth. Working in small sections, apply the polish with light pressure. After polishing, you should wipe the car with a clean cloth.
The importance of regular car cleaning
Cleaning your car regularly is more than just a cosmetic matter. It contributes significantly to maintaining the value and longevity of your vehicle. Over time, dirt and debris can corrode the paint and cause rust.
